Grown Ups (2010)

Boys will be boys. . . some longer than others.

Grown Ups (2010) poster

After their high school basketball coach passes away, five good friends and former teammates reunite for a Fourth of July holiday weekend.

Director: Dennis Dugan
Genre: Comedy
Runtime: 102 min

Music: Rupert Gregson-Williams
Cinematography: Theo van de Sande
Editing: Tom Costain
Production: Columbia Pictures, Relativity Media, Happy Madison Productions
Country: United States of America
Language: English
Budget: $80M
Box Office: $271M
